Second-harmonic microscopy in optically confining nanostructures

The influence of geometrical confinement in back-reflection Second-Harmonic microscopy is experimentally and theoretically investigated in the wedge-shaped model system lithium niobate. The co-propagating signal is found to be the dominating contribution.
